### Seat-map renderer: restart procedure

Before restarting the Velmont Playhouse renderer, drain in-flight render jobs via the admin endpoint and confirm the tile cache has flushed; a cold restart mid-render leaves partial seat overlays that confuse the booking UI. Reviewers should verify each change against the active render parameters. The values currently loaded in production are reproduced below.

deployment values, fadug-bawif:
SORWYN_LOG_LEVEL=debug
SORWYN_METRICS_HOST=metrics.sorwyn.qirvansys.internal
SORWYN_POOL_SIZE=32

## Onboarding: LedgerCore ORM Refactor

Welcome. We're replacing the legacy Quillbase ORM with the new mapper layer, table by table. Rules: no new queries against Quillbase models, shims only. Each migrated module ships behind a compatibility test suite; don't merge without green parity runs. Migration branches deploy through the staging pipeline, which requires signed commits — unsigned pushes are rejected at the gate. Register your machine with the build service on day one. The team's shared deploy key for the staging pipeline is below.

signing key of bagap-yawep = bky13_TbfT6ZMUoGJo2

## Reseller Programme — Managers Only

Welcome. Quick facts for the incoming director: the Vantrel Reseller Programme covers 14 partners across the Ostrev region. Tier margins run 12–22%. Quarterly certification is mandatory; two partners (Korlim Systems, Bexa Trading) are currently lapsed. Renewal decisions sit with regional leads; escalations go to Marit Sovden. Partner churn last year was 9%, mostly small accounts. Budget for partner enablement is fixed through Q3. The note below outlines where the programme goes next.

internal memo for hahaf-bajef: Headcount on the Zorael team goes from 7 to 140 by the end of July. Gross margin on Zorael came in at 15 percent against a plan of 15 percent.

Handover note — Crumbwheel order cutoffs.

Welcome aboard. The bakery cutoff rule in Crumbwheel closes same-day orders at 14:00 local to each storefront, not UTC — this has bitten us twice. Holiday overrides live in the calendar service and take precedence silently, so always check there first when a cutoff looks wrong. To unlock the calendar service's admin console after a restart, enter the recovery passphrase below.

vault phrase of bagap-bahaf = silion-pelox-sorox-casdor-quenwyn-fraax-eliox-praael-kelion-quenvan-kasox-rusael-norius-belvan